Job Description
Elevate your career as a Part-Time Accounting and Payroll Administrator at Camphill Communities Ontario in Barrie, Ontario. This role emphasizes critical financial recordkeeping and payroll management responsibilities.
In this part-time position, you will work 24 hours a week, reporting to the Director of Finance. Key responsibilities include bookkeeping tasks, payroll processing, and collaboration with HR to maintain accurate employee records. Your proficiency with accounting software will be essential to ensure compliance with CRA guidelines and GAAP.
Key Responsibilities:
• Code and reconcile operational transactions
• Compute numerical data for financial records
• Prepare payroll cheques bi-weekly
• Train new staff on accounting tasks
• Maintain accurate employee attendance records
Requirements:
• Minimum three years of payroll or bookkeeping experience
• Advanced diploma in accounting or equivalent
